Taste of Vail is a platform for promoting the Vail lifestyle via the community's ever-evolving food and beverage assets. this is done through the organization's iconic food and wine event in the spring, along with additional activities throughout the year designed to support and elevate the community.
the challenge —
The Taste of Vail is a non-profit organization founded in 1990 by a group of food and wine enthusiasts. We support the amazing chefs and wineries of our valley and from all over the world. There are many good reasons why a consumer may consider attending the Taste of Vail. The purpose of branding is to find out how to best capture the consumer’s attention… how to tell the story in order to sell the opportunity.
Brands are not tangible in the sense that they can be contained in a logo or captured in a website. The brand is what is left over after the last marketing dollar has been spent: it is a collection of thoughts, opinions, and perceptions that exist in the minds of consumers.
Creating a well-defined brand with a compelling value proposition is only the beginning. In order to achieve better exposure, brands have to be put to work. This is the job of implementing the brand with a fully integrated brand identity, website, social media and public relations campaign.
As chefs, restaurateurs, and business owners, the inclination is to try to “say it all.” As marketers and brand strategists, the mandate is to say it simply and clearly. This requires defining a compelling value proposition. The purpose of branding is to find that one kernel of inspiration that allows us to develop a brand messaging platform that clearly communicates the core value proposition of Taste of Vail. The first step of defining the core value proposition is to first understand the brand’s assets and liabilities.
As a result of our recent creative brief survey and in-depth conversations with members of our community, Vail Resorts, and other local businesses, we have arrived at a list of assets and liabilities that will affect the Taste of Vail brand perception.
